The Dark Tournament Stadium

The Dark Tournament (暗黒武術会, Ankoku Bujutsukai, translated as Dark Martial Arts Association), consisting of sixteen teams made up of five fighters each, is a dark martial arts competition held on Hanging Neck Island and is the setting for the second saga of Yū Yū Hakushō.

In the Filipino dub of the anime, this is known as the Toguro Tournament.

Overview

The Dark Tournament is a vile martial arts competition organized by greedy human crime lords, and draws the attention of some of the most wretched demons of Spirit World. According to Younger Toguro, wealthy human gamblers and businesses owners come to the tournament for betting and entertainment from the fights, while the demons enter for sake of blood and chance to wish for anything they want.

As indicated by Kurama, the idea of mercy has never been a part of the tournament, meaning any tactic to defeat the opponent goes. According to Hiei the only law of the competition is the strongest combatant prevails.

Staff

Committee

The tournament is headed by a committee, who, consisting of several wealthy humans, creates the event's rules and oversees each individual match to determine its legitimacy. Possessing limitless power in all event circumstances, the committee has the final word on every major tournament decision, including the outcome of all fights. In addition, it is the committee's job to award the tournament's champions with a granting of one wish, which is considered the grand prize of the event. Like all affiliates of the dark tournament, the committee is extremely corrupt, often abusing its authority to overturn legitimate decisions by the referees, including multiple instances at the expense of Team Urameshi. (Though this stopped by the semi-finals, as Hiei threatened to kill them for their constant interference during round two.) Despite their corruption and greed, even they were disgusted by Sakyo's plan to open the gate to the demon world, and swore to stop him, though were killed by Toguro.

Every year, special guests are invited to fight in the tournament. Althought it may seem to be an honor, it is quite the contrary. These guests have no choice in the decision of fighting, and if they are absent in the tournament, they are written on a kill list and will be murdered by an assassin. (In short the committee expects special guests to die in the tournament.)

Referees

The first referee, Koto, watched the matches and started the ten count should a fighter fall. During the finals and the semi-finals, she acted as an announcer.

The second, Juri, took over for Koto when she was "promoted" during the finals.

Prize

The prize for winning the tournament was one wish for each person on the winning team.

The Toguro Brothers wished to be converted into demons of the highest class (though they were technically B class; though they were technically the strongest class permitted in the Human World), while Genkai wished to never be a part of such a tournament again. The wishes of the other two members are not revealed; though its possible they died in the final round.

Team Urameshi collectively wished for the resurrection of Genkai, which Koenma granted. In a sense of irony, Toguro granted Hiei's wish when he secretly murdered the committee for Sakyo. Kuwabara wanted fame, so his reputation would scare off any would-be attacker from Yukina; simply winning the Tournament got him fame.

Destruction

Sakyo had bet his life on Team Toguro's victory, while Koenma bet his upon Team Urameshi. When Yusuke and his team won the finals, Sakyo was true to his word. He activated a self-destruct protocol on the arena, which collapsed and killed him in the process.
